Global Landscapes Forum Bonn 2019

22 Junio 2019 - 23 Junio 2019
Bonn
Germany

In 2019 the Global Landscapes Forum (GLF) will focus the world’s attention on the fundamental importance of rights to address the current environmental crisis. Linking people to landscapes, the GLF will explore the essential contributions of indigenous peoples, local communities, and rural and indigenous women and youth in achieving the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and the Paris Agreement targets on climate change, highlighting the transformative role of rights and rights-based approaches in securing a more just, sustainable and prosperous future for all. Woven across the year’s events, these priorities will form the centerpiece of the annual conference in Bonn, Germany – to be held on June 22–23 alongside the intersessional climate talks – making it the world’s single largest forum on rights and sustainable landscapes.

Cuando los mercados de carbono van mal: cómo garantizar el acceso a la reparación en caso de violaciones de la tenencia de la tierra

07 Febrero 2024

Este seminario web explorará cómo podría ser el acceso a la reparación para las comunidades en el sistema del mercado mundial del carbono, centrándose en cuestiones de tenencia de la tierra y los recursos. Escuchando a las comunidades afectadas por los mercados de carbono y a expertos en el diseño de mecanismos de reclamación, el seminario web destacará las características clave necesarias para que los mecanismos de reclamación sean accesibles, fiables y creíbles. El debate ofrecerá una aportación fundamental al mecanismo de reclamación propuesto para los mercados establecidos en virtud del artículo 6.4 del Acuerdo de París de la CMNUCC.
